Default Pokemon Warstory Thread


This is the place to share any interesting battle stories with other Pokemon trainers. Though Warstories typically refer to competitive battles, feel free to share any interesting in-game battles you might have had.


To the Bitter End

My team:

My comments/thoughts will be in this color.

Battle between NDenizen and Logitech started!

Tier: Gen5 OverUsed
Variation: +12, -20
Rule: Rated
Rule: Sleep Clause
Rule: Freeze Clause
Rule: Challenge Cup
Rule: Species Clause

Logitech sent out Thunderus!
NDenizen sent out Alomomola!

Start of turn 1
Thunderus used Thunderbolt!
It's super effective!
The foe's Alomomola lost 75% of its health!

The foe's Alomomola used Mirror Coat!
Thunderus lost 299 HP! (99% of its health)
Thunderus hung on using its focus sash!
I was unfamiliar with an Alomomola lead, so I used Thunderbolt hoping for either a SE hit or a free hit on a switch. Mirror Coat caught me by surprise, but Thunderus held on thanks to focus sash.
Start of turn 2
NDenizen called Alomomola back!
The foe's Alomomola regains health with its Regeneration!
NDenizen sent out Breloom!

Thunderus used Thunderbolt!
It's not very effective...
The foe's Breloom lost 43% of its health!
I used Thunderbolt again hoping to get a free hit on what ever my opponent switched in. In hindsight I probably should have used T-Wave to cripple the incoming Pokemon.
Start of turn 3
Thunderus used Taunt!
The foe's Breloom fell for the taunt!

The foe's Breloom used Mach Punch!
It's not very effective...
Thunderus lost 1 HP! (0% of its health)
Thunderus fainted!
I was afraid of the Sub-Punching Breloom set, so I used Taunt to prevent his Breloom from setting up. Unfortunately, he Mach Punched my Thunderus.
SCORE:6-5 Favoring my opponent.

Logitech sent out Crustle!

Start of turn 4
Crustle used Stealth Rock!
Pointed stones float in the air around NDenizen's team!

The foe's Breloom used Bullet Seed!
Crustle lost 64 HP! (22% of its health)
Crustle lost 63 HP! (22% of its health)
Crustle lost 58 HP! (20% of its health)
Crustle lost 57 HP! (20% of its health)
Hit 4 times!
I set up SR.
Start of turn 5
The foe's Breloom used Mach Punch!
Crustle lost 39 HP! (13% of its health)
Crustle fainted!
Here I tried to get up a layer of spikes because I predicted he would predict a switch and try to get in a more powerful move. I was wrong.
SCORE:6-4 Favoring my opponent.

The foe's Breloom's taunt ended!
Logitech sent out Darmantian!

Start of turn 6
The foe's Breloom used Mach Punch!
Darmantian lost 198 HP! (56% of its health)

Darmantian used Flare Blitz!
It's super effective!
The foe's Breloom lost 56% of its health!
The foe's Breloom fainted!
Darmantian is hit with recoil!
I send in my Choice Scarf Darmantian to revenge kill his Breloom. He used Mach Punch which took a large chunk of Darmantian's HP, but Darmantian succeeded in getting the revenge kill, albeit at the cost of A LOT of HP
SCORE:5-4 Favoring my opponent.

NDenizen sent out Alomomola!
Pointed stones dug into the foe's Alomomola!

Start of turn 7
Logitech called Darmantian back!
Logitech sent out Sazandora!

The foe's Alomomola used Wish!
With Darmantian locked in Fire Blitz, I didn't want to risk not KO-ing Alomomola and losing him, so I switched.
Start of turn 8
Sazandora used Draco Meteor!
The foe's Alomomola lost 45% of its health!
The foe's Alomomola fainted!
Sazandora's Sp. Att. sharply fell!
Predicting a switch, I use Draco Meteor to hit anything that switched in for a good chunk of HP. He didn't switch and Sazandora got the KO.
SCORE:Tied 4-4.

NDenizen sent out Conkeldurr!
Pointed stones dug into the foe's Conkeldurr!

Start of turn 9
Logitech called Sazandora back!
Logitech sent out Chandelure!

The foe's Conkeldurr used Drain Punch!
It had no effect!

The foe's Conkeldurr rest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
I expected the Conkeldurr to use Drain Punch against Sazandora, so I switched into Chandelure.
Start of turn 10
Chandelure used Flamethrower!
The foe's Conkeldurr lost 85% of its health!
The foe's Conkeldurr was burned!
Chandelure is hurt by its Life Orb!

The foe's Conkeldurr used Foresight!
The foe's Conkeldurr identified Chandelure!

The foe's Conkeldurr rest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
The foe's Conkeldurr is hurt by its burn!
I used Flamethrower, but it still wasn't enough to KO his Conkeldurr, even with the boost from Life Orb. He used Foresight, which was a bit surprising to me (I expected Payback)
Start of turn 11
The foe's Conkeldurr used Mach Punch!
A critical hit!
Chandelure lost 236 HP! (90% of its health)
Chandelure fainted!

The foe's Conkeldurr rest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
The foe's Conkeldurr is hurt by its burn!

Logitech sent out Conkeldurr!
Foresight allowed him to Mach Punch my Chandelure, scoring a Crit which KOed it. I send out my own Conkeldurr to revenge kill his.
SCORE:4-3 Favoring my opponent.

Start of turn 12
Conkeldurr used Mach Punch!
The foe's Conkeldurr lost 1% of its health!
The foe's Conkeldurr fainted!
I used Mach Punch and revenge killed his Conkeldurr.
SCORE:Tied 3-3

NDenizen sent out Reuniclus!

Start of turn 13
Conkeldurr used Payback!
It's super effective!
The foe's Reuniclus lost 31% of its health!

The foe's Reuniclus used Trick Room!
The foe's Reuniclus twisted the dimensions!

Start of turn 14
The foe's Reuniclus used Psycho Shock!
It's super effective!
Conkeldurr lost 396 HP! (95% of its health)

Conkeldurr used Payback!
It's super effective!
The foe's Reuniclus lost 62% of its health!
My Conkeldurr barely survived Psycho Shock, allowing it to hit Reuniclus hard with Payback.
Conkeldurr restored a little HP using its Leftovers!

Start of turn 15
Conkeldurr used Mach Punch!
It's not very effective...
The foe's Reuniclus lost 6% of its health!
The foe's Reuniclus fainted!
I was able to KO his Reuniclus with Mach Punch.
SCORE:3-2 Favoring me.

Conkeldurr rest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
NDenizen sent out Clefable!
Pointed stones dug into the foe's Clefable!
At this point I was feeling pretty good. I was up 3-2, and my Conkeldurr had a serious type advantage over Clefable. However, things don't always go as one hopes...
TO BE CONTINUED...

CONTINUED...

Start of turn 16
Conkeldurr used Drain Punch!
It's super effective!
The foe's Clefable lost 59% of its health!
The foe's Clefable had its energy drained!

The foe's Clefable used Moonlight!
The foe's Clefable regained health!

Conkeldurr rest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
The foe's Clefable rest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
I was hoping Drain Punch would have done more damage. Maybe I'm not in such good shape after all?
Start of turn 17
Conkeldurr used Bulk Up!
Conkeldurr's Attack rose!
Conkeldurr's Defense rose!

The foe's Clefable used Moonlight!
The foe's Clefable regained health!

Conkeldurr rest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
The twisted dimensions returned to normal!

Start of turn 18
The foe's Clefable used Cosmic Power!
The foe's Clefable's Defense rose!
The foe's Clefable's Sp. Def. rose!

Conkeldurr used Drain Punch!
It's super effective!
The foe's Clefable lost 38% of its health!
The foe's Clefable had its energy drained!

The foe's Clefable rest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
Conkeldurr rest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
At this point I realized Clefable's Cosmic Power was going to beat my Bulk Up. After one of each, Drain Punch's damage went from %59 to %38. Not Good. I have no Pokemon to phase out Clefable, so all I'm left with is Bulking Up to counter the Cosmic Powers.
Start of turn 19
The foe's Clefable used Cosmic Power!
The foe's Clefable's Defense rose!
The foe's Clefable's Sp. Def. rose!

Conkeldurr used Drain Punch!
It's super effective!
The foe's Clefable lost 27% of its health!
The foe's Clefable had its energy drained!

The foe's Clefable rest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
Conkeldurr restored a little HP using its Leftovers!

Start of turn 20
The foe's Clefable used Moonlight!
The foe's Clefable regained health!

Conkeldurr used Bulk Up!
Conkeldurr's Attack rose!
Conkeldurr's Defense rose!

The foe's Clefable restored a little HP using its Leftovers!

Start of turn 21
The foe's Clefable used Cosmic Power!
The foe's Clefable's Defense rose!
The foe's Clefable's Sp. Def. rose!

Conkeldurr used Bulk Up!
Conkeldurr's Attack rose!
Conkeldurr's Defense rose!

Start of turn 22
The foe's Clefable used Cosmic Power!
The foe's Clefable's Defense rose!
The foe's Clefable's Sp. Def. rose!

Conkeldurr used Bulk Up!
Conkeldurr's Attack rose!
Conkeldurr's Defense rose!

Start of turn 23
The foe's Clefable used Cosmic Power!
The foe's Clefable's Defense rose!
The foe's Clefable's Sp. Def. rose!

Conkeldurr used Bulk Up!
Conkeldurr's Attack rose!
Conkeldurr's Defense rose!

Start of turn 24
The foe's Clefable used Cosmic Power!
The foe's Clefable's Defense rose!
The foe's Clefable's Sp. Def. rose!

Conkeldurr used Bulk Up!
Conkeldurr's Attack rose!
Conkeldurr's Defense rose!
At this point we are both are at maximum stat boosts. I realize that I only have 2 ways of winning at this point: 1) Outstalling with Clefable Drain Punch or 2) Score a critical hit.
Start of turn 25
The foe's Clefable used Toxic!
Conkeldurr was poisoned!

Conkeldurr used Drain Punch!
It's super effective!
The foe's Clefable lost 20% of its health!
The foe's Clefable had its energy drained!

The foe's Clefable rest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
Conkeldurr is hurt by poison!
Well ****. There goes any hope of outstalling Clefable. Toxic does boost Conkeldurr's attack, but it doesn't really matter at this point, I NEED A CRIT!
Start of turn 26
The foe's Clefable used Flamethrower!
Conkeldurr lost 57 HP! (13% of its health)

Conkeldurr used Drain Punch!
It's super effective!
The foe's Clefable lost 19% of its health!
The foe's Clefable had its energy drained!

The foe's Clefable rest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
Conkeldurr rest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
Conkeldurr is hurt by poison!
No crit.
Start of turn 27
The foe's Clefable used Flamethrower!
Conkeldurr lost 63 HP! (15% of its health)

Conkeldurr used Drain Punch!
It's super effective!
The foe's Clefable lost 22% of its health!
The foe's Clefable had its energy drained!

The foe's Clefable rest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
Conkeldurr rest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
Conkeldurr is hurt by poison!
No crit.
Start of turn 28
The foe's Clefable used Flamethrower!
Conkeldurr lost 66 HP! (15% of its health)

Conkeldurr used Drain Punch!
It's super effective!
The foe's Clefable lost 21% of its health!
The foe's Clefable had its energy drained!

The foe's Clefable rest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
Conkeldurr rest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
Conkeldurr is hurt by poison!
No crit.
Start of turn 29
The foe's Clefable used Moonlight!
The foe's Clefable regained health!

Conkeldurr used Drain Punch!
It's super effective!
The foe's Clefable lost 21% of its health!
The foe's Clefable had its energy drained!

The foe's Clefable rest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
Conkeldurr rest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
Conkeldurr is hurt by poison!
No crit.
Start of turn 30
The foe's Clefable used Flamethrower!
Conkeldurr lost 59 HP! (14% of its health)

Conkeldurr used Drain Punch!
It's super effective!
The foe's Clefable lost 22% of its health!
The foe's Clefable had its energy drained!

The foe's Clefable rest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
Conkeldurr restored a little HP using its Leftovers!
Conkeldurr is hurt by poison!
Conkeldurr fainted!
No crit. Conkelldurr is out. Almost all hope is lost...
SCORE:Tied 2-2... But I'm ****ed.

Logitech sent out Darmantian!

Start of turn 31
Darmantian used Superpower!
It's super effective!
A critical hit!
The foe's Clefable lost 57% of its health!
The foe's Clefable fainted!
Darmantian's Attack fell!
Darmantian's Defense fell!
WHAT'S THIS?! A CRIT?! MAYBE THERE'S A CHANCE?!
SCORE:2-1 Favoring me.

NDenizen sent out Genesect!
Pointed stones dug into the foe's Genesect!

Genesect's Download raised its Special Attack!

Start of turn 32
Logitech called Darmantian back!
Logitech sent out Sazandora!
Darmantian was locked into Superpower, in addition to having -1 ATK. I had to switch.
The foe's Genesect used Ice Beam!
It's super effective!
Sazandora lost 325 HP! (100% of its health)
Sazandora fainted!

SCORE: Tied 1-1

Logitech sent out Darmantian!

Start of turn 33
Darmantian used Flare Blitz!
The foe's Genesect lost 88% of its health!
The foe's Genesect fainted!
There was only one way for me to cleanly KO Genesect: Fire Blitz. However, in doing so I knew the recoil would also KO Darmantian.
Darmantian is hit with recoil!
Darmantian fainted!

SCORE: Tied 0-0
HOWEVER, due to the tiebreaker rules, the side who's last Pokemon faints first loses. Therefore...
Logitech won the battle!
I chose this battle because of all the emotional roller coaster it entailed. Even though it wasn't a great display of competitive battling (I made several mistakes in this battle, and so did my opponent) I thought the ups and downs along with the ending made it worthwhile (for me at least.) I hope you enjoyed it!
